Brabus Island, located in Al Raha, Abu Dhabi, is a premium waterfront residential development developed by Cosmo Developments. Designed for those who seek a life of elegance and tranquility, this exclusive island project presents a new standard of living in one of Abu Dhabi’s most desirable locations. The architecture blends modern aesthetics with the serene backdrop of Al Raha, offering residents a unique fusion of natural beauty and contemporary comfort.
This luxurious development features spacious 2, 3, and 4-bedroom apartments, each crafted with fine attention to detail. From expansive windows that frame stunning sea views to thoughtfully designed interiors, every element reflects sophistication. The development offers the privacy of island living without compromising accessibility, ensuring that residents enjoy peaceful seclusion and convenient urban connectivity.
Created with a vision for refined living, this project is more than just a place to live—it’s a lifestyle. With high-end amenities, scenic waterfront views, and a location surrounded by blue horizons, the project is tailored for families, professionals, and investors alike. Whether looking for a permanent home or a smart investment, this development delivers luxury, functionality, and timeless charm in every square foot.
Brabus Island by Cosmo Developments for Sale in Al Raha, Abu Dhabi Call us at +971 44475431.
Brabus Island offers a lifestyle that goes beyond the home. The development features many amenities, including a state-of-the-art fitness center, temperature-controlled swimming pools, children’s play areas, jogging tracks, and landscaped gardens. Residents can enjoy waterfront dining, retail outlets, and dedicated wellness zones catering to relaxation and recreation. With 24/7 security and concierge services, comfort and peace of mind are part of everyday living.
10%
Down Payment
20%
During Construction
70%
On Handover
Cash
Bank Transfer
Bitcoin
Credit Card
Cheque
2 Bedroom Apartment
Size: On Request
Price: On Request
3 Bedroom Apartment
Size: On Request
Price: On Request
4 Bedroom Apartment
Size: On Request
Price: On Request
Brabus Island presents a selection of carefully curated floor plans that cater to various family sizes and lifestyle needs.
The master plan of Brabus Island reflects a deep understanding of community living while prioritizing privacy and luxury.
Brabus Island is located in the iconic Al Raha area of Abu Dhabi—a sought-after destination known for its waterfront charm and convenient access to the city.
Brabus Island presents a selection of carefully curated floor plans that cater to various family sizes and lifestyle needs.
The master plan of Brabus Island reflects a deep understanding of community living while prioritizing privacy and luxury.
Brabus Island is located in the iconic Al Raha area of Abu Dhabi—a sought-after destination known for its waterfront charm and convenient access to the city.
Compare listings
Compare